Summary[edit] Description: English: This great cormorant (Phalacrocorax carbo) is drying its feathers. Although this birds spend a great part of their time on the water, their feathers are not water-repellent. Therefore, they are commonly seen with their wings spread, in order to get their feathers dry. Português: Este corvo-marinho-de-faces-brancas (Phalacrocorax carbo) está a secar as penas.
